Introduction to PowerShell for Windows 7
PowerShell for Windows 7 leverages the same core functionality that powers the latest version but with some adjustments and compatibility considerations. The key features include:
- Command Line Interface: PowerShell provides an interactive command-line interface similar to Unix/Linux systems.
- Scripting Language: It allows you to write scripts that can be executed at a higher level than batch files or simple commands.
- Automation: Enables automation of repetitive tasks across different applications and services.
- Configuration Management: Helps in managing complex server environments through configuration files and policies.

Basic Commands and Features
Here are some basic commands and features of PowerShell for Windows 7:
-
Basic Commands:
Get-Process | Select-Object Name, Id, Status
-
Environment Variables:
$env:path $env:Path += ";C:\Program Files\Git\bin"
-
Variables:
$myVar = "Hello, World!" Write-Host "$myVar"
-
Functions and Scripts: Create a new function:
Function MyFunction { param ( [string]$Message ) Write-Output "Executing $Message" } MyFunction "Hello from PowerShell!"
-
Piping Data: Pipe data from one cmdlet to another:
Get-WmiObject Win32_OperatingSystem | Select-Object Caption, LastBootUpTime
